How to make one manual backup (no plugin needed)
Sometimes you want a backup right now, before a big change. Your site has two halves, and you need both.
1. The files (your themes, plugins, images). Log into your hosting control panel, the website where you manage your hosting account. Find File Manager, select the folder named after your site, and click Compress to make one zip you can download.
2. The database (your actual posts and settings, stored in a separate filing cabinet). In the control panel, open the tool called phpMyAdmin, choose your database on the left, click Export, then Go.
Save both files somewhere safe with today's date in the name.
In plain words: a real backup is two pieces, the files and the database, grab both or you've only saved half.
